Location
The 4-star Buccaneers Boutique Guest House St. Paul's Bay is located near an entertainment district, only 5 minutes' walk from St. Paul's Shipwreck Church. The hotel lies about 2 km from Il-Wardija, and offers an à la carte restaurant and an outdoor swimming pool onsite.
Plajja Tal'Bognor is a mere 250 metres away, and Dive Deep Blue is in proximity to this St. Paul's Bay guest house. Natural attractions in the area include Splash & Fun Water Park, around 10 minutes by car from the Buccaneers Boutique Guest House, and a beach is nearly 10 minutes' walk away. Guests will also appreciate the vicinity to Kennedy Grove, located 1.2 km away. A few moments from this accommodation you'll find the Malta Chocolate Factory. Bugibba - Anthony bus stop, offering a direct link to the city attractions and main places, is right near the Buccaneers Boutique Guest House St. Paul's Bay.
There are 30 rooms at this hotel, each of them has an ironing set and air conditioning, as well as entertainment amenities such as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els. Fitted with tea and coffee making facilities, the rooms also come with a writing desk. Bathrooms include a walk-in shower and a separate toilet, along with such comforts as complimentary toiletries and bath sheets. They offer views of the courtyard.
Buccaneers Boutique Guest House offers a daily continental breakfast. A wide selection of international specialities is offered in the on-site restaurant. The lounge bar will set you up nicely for enjoying your stay. The restaurant The Buccaneers Restaurant is steps from the property.
Review by hotel critic
During my recent stay at the Buccaneers Boutique Guest House, I had the pleasure of experiencing their onsite restaurant, which specializes in Italian cuisine. As an environmental scientist, I appreciate establishments that weave sustainability into their operations, and the Buccaneers does this thoughtfully. I opted for a leisurely dinner and selected a homemade pasta dish that pleasantly highlighted local ingredients. The ambiance of the restaurant was inviting, with warm lighting that complemented the soft music playing in the background. It was an ideal setting to unwind and enjoy a satisfying meal. The breakfast options, while limited, provided a decent start to the day, featuring a combination of continental and buffet-style offerings. I indulged in a simple yet delightful selection of fresh fruit and pastries, albeit wishing for a broader range. One standout aspect was the bar/lounge where the staff cheerfully served a selection of beverages, quenching my thirst with local wines that had a distinct regional character. Those who appreciate culinary innovation in a sustainable setting will undoubtedly find a rewarding experience here.
